Get in Touch** The Volkswagen repair market for Richwood residents is characterized by a need to travel to nearby commercial centers for specialized service. Within Richwood itself, general repair shops can handle basic maintenance but lack the specific tools, software, and trained expertise for complex VW systems like DSG transmissions, TDI engines, or EV diagnostics. The top-tier providers are concentrated in Beckley (~45-50 minute drive) and Lewisburg (~35-40 minute drive). These shops offer a competitive market with a clear distinction: independent specialists (Import Auto Service, German Auto Works) often provide more personalized service and potentially lower labor rates for complex mechanical repairs, while the dealership (Elk VW South) is the definitive source for warranty work, software updates, and EV service. Pricing for specialized work is premium across the board due to the required expertise and equipment, but the competition between these top providers helps maintain a high standard of quality and fair market rates. Customers are advised to choose based on their specific need—dealership for warranty/EV issues, and independents for mechanical repairs and performance tuning.

In the Richwood area, you'll find specialized independent mechanics and general repair shops that service Volkswagens. For complex electrical or transmission issues, many local owners rely on trusted shops in nearby Summersville or Beckley that have specific VW diagnostic tools and certified technicians, which is important for modern models.
Given Richwood's hilly terrain and winter weather, common issues include premature brake wear, suspension component failure, and problems with the cooling system. For older VW models popular in the area, like the Jetta or Golf, also watch for check engine lights related to oxygen sensors or mass airflow sensors, which can be exacerbated by temperature fluctuations.
Volkswagen repair costs in Richwood are typically higher than for domestic brands but comparable to other European makes. This is due to specialized parts and labor; sourcing parts can sometimes add time if they need to be ordered from larger distributors outside the immediate area, impacting overall cost.
For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) and many common repairs, a qualified local shop in Richwood or Nicholas County is perfectly capable. However, for major warranty work, complex recalls, or advanced electronic issues on newer models, the nearest Volkswagen dealerships in Beckley or Charleston are the recommended destinations.
